A worldwide review of smoking cessation from 2014 to 2023 has found that the best way to quit cigarettes is to switch from regular cigarette to nicotine-filled e-cigarettes. The study also found that nicotine-laden e-cigs were better at kicking butts than nicotine replacement methods such as patches, gums, lozenges, and behavioral support. However, the CDC has stated that switching from regular to e-cigarette is not an improvement. Despite their similarities to old-fashioned cigarettes and their harmful aerosols, they are uniquely harmful in their own ways. They contain cancer-causing chemicals and tiny particles that can be inhaled deep into lungs, which can lead to serious health issues like secondhand smoke. Despite this, the review highlighted some gaps in existing research that might lead to less harmful alternatives.
